About Sahara Investment Group
Sahara Investment Group (“SIG”) is a direct commercial real estate lender and investor based in Las Vegas, NV, focused on flexible, fast, and creative financing solutions. We target investments across all real estate asset types in select Southwest and Mountain West markets.
SIG operates as part of an integrated platform with its sister company, CORE Advisory Partners, which provides capital markets and strategic advisory services to real estate developers, family offices, and investors. This shared structure enhances SIG’s market intelligence, sourcing capabilities, and execution resources.
We invest through a discretionary fund structure and closed our second fund in April 2024.
